The live trucks SOMETIMES have a truck operator...but that person is inside the truck, overseeing the transmission of the signal to the station (and frankly THAT person is usually all alone in the truck, so a target himself/herself).

Some news stations have "one-man-bands" for their field crews, meaning the reporter IS ALSO the cameraman and does all his own photography.

When I was a photog, it was reporters with a cameraman. DAily, there were one or two photogs who were sent out to pick up random interviews or video ALL ALONE.

It's a dangerous job. I was attacked a few times (had things thrown at me, had and off duty LEO try to run me over with his car). My colleagues were also the brunt of a few attacks. Unless the stations are planning on hiring armed guards to escort their crews around...

It's not going to be policy, especially in smaller markets (which Roanoke is). Larger markets might have a dedicated operator for the live truck, but they're probably staying in the truck during the live shots. Some markets will hire security to go with their crews if they're going into suspect locations (I'm assuming there was some security and extra eyes with crews in Ferguson for example), but not on a routine basis. Will this single event cause some stations to send extra bodies out? Maybe. But I don't see it lasting long.

Yes, this is a tragedy, but I don't think (based on what's released so far) it could have been prevented realistically.
